How Micro Incineration Works
Micro incineration devices utilize a controlled air combustion process to rapidly and efficiently burn organic waste. The process involves:
- Waste is manually fed into the chamber.
- Air is drawn into the chamber and mixed with the waste.
- The mixture is then ignited and rapidly burned.
- The resulting gases are then channeled through a catalytic converter, where harmful pollutants are neutralized.
- The remaining ash is collected and disposed of responsibly.

Applications in Tanzania
Micro incineration solutions have numerous applications in Tanzania, including:
- Urban areas: Reducing waste in densely populated cities and generating energy.
- Rural communities: Providing a reliable waste management solution in areas with limited access to infrastructure.
- Agricultural waste: Efficiently disposing of agricultural waste and generating bio-based fertilizers.
